Physics-based multiplayer soccer game where teamwork is key. Browser based with peer-to-peer networking for up to 20 players. Includes private rooms and a selection of fields.

Why our public status pages are better than others?
We rely on the combination of both automated checks and user reported issues. Quite often, purely automated uptime monitoring cannot provide the full picture.
-
How often do you check if a service is down?
If there are reported issues or interest in a specific service, we might check as frequently as every minute. However, we may check less frequently for services with less interest or fewer reported issues. For example, once every hour.
